Technological Innovations Promoting Responsible Gambling

Innovation Impact on Responsible Gambling
Real-time Data Analytics Enables platforms to monitor player behaviour continuously, flagging patterns indicative of problem gambling.
Self-Exclusion Tools Allow players to set limits or temporarily ban themselves, fostering autonomy and control.
AI-Powered Personalised Interventions Identify at-risk individuals and deliver tailored messages or support links proactively.
Secure Payment Systems Implement advanced encryption and verified deposits/withdrawals to prevent fraud and underage access.

Balancing Business Growth with Ethical Responsibilities

While the landscape offers significant revenue opportunities, industry leaders acknowledge that sustainable growth hinges on responsible practices. Regulatory frameworks such as the UK’s Gambling Act 2005 and recent updates to the UK Gambling Commission emphasize transparency, fair play, and consumer protection. Entities are increasingly adopting responsible gambling tools—such as reality checks, deposit limits, and account restrictions—to support at-risk players.

For instance, some platforms incorporate behavioral analytics to dynamically adapt promotional content or provide real-time warning messages, helping players manage their betting habits effectively. Such measures are backed by data showing a decline in gambling-related harm where proactive interventions are deployed successfully.
